Taletan Ijo is an online shop that sells fruit seeds. In carrying out its business processes, he utilizes a sales information system. The system is used to manage sales data. If the data is not used, it will lead to accumulation of data but lack of information. Taletan ijo uses the manual method in its product marketing strategy so that the strategy used is not quite right. Stored sales transaction data can be used as a reference in making marketing strategies such as making product sales packages. This study uses data mining methods, namely associations with a priori algorithms to process transaction data into information that can help support decisions in determining marketing strategies. The results of the study show that the lift ratio test results obtained are 3.2 which indicates that the value is valid with a minimum number of transactions of 10 and a confidence value of 80.

Most game s are used as a means of entertainment, but can also function as a means of training, education and simulation. In the field of education, educational game s can be applied by adopting educational materials to be informed in an interesting way to users. To provide a challenge to the user, the concept of level and scoring is applied in the game . The type of game made is a quiz-based educational game . Elements of educational game s made in the form of text, images, sounds and videos regarding knowledge about the classification of vertebrate and invertebrate animals. The data and answers used in the quiz are also displayed in a random way. The randomization process uses a random generator that applies the concept of Multiplicative Congruential Random Number Generator (CRNG). The use of this generator is intended so that users get different questions and answer compositions at each level. This is so that the user does not get bored quickly and the game becomes more interesting to play. So that the user indirectly conducts learning activities because the information conveyed is in the form of knowledge that is packaged in the form of a game.

Current technological developments make it easier for people to share information and carry out communication activities through instant messaging applications using multimedia features in the form of audio and video. Technology has been able to contribute and facilitate humans in a positive sense, but it can also be misused to carry out negative activities. In solving crime problems using instant messages, investigators need to carry out digital forensics, including on mobile devices such as smartphones. This study aims to obtain digital evidence of online drug sales scenarios via Facebook messenger and WhatsApp using four forensic tools, namely Belkasoft, Oxygen, MOBILedit, and Magnet Axiom. The National Institute of Justice (NIJ) is used as a framework with stages, namely identification, solution, testing, evaluation, and reporting of results. out of the four tools, MOBILedit cannot recover deleted audio and video while the other three tools can recover deleted audio and video.

The rapid development of Internet of Things (IoT) technology makes its use even more widespread in various fields. IoT is a series of technologies that are combined to create a device that can be controlled remotely via the internet. In this study, IoT technology is applied to control and monitor hydroponic plants using one of the IoT devices, the NodeMCU ESP32. The purpose of this research is to create an automatic nutrition system for hydroponic plants by utilizing various sensors and monitoring the development of hydroponic plants remotely via the internet to see the performance of IoT technology in controlling and monitoring. The results of this study indicate that the application of IoT technology can precisely provide nutrients to hydroponic plants according to the specified time and can transmit data accurately and in real-time via the internet and displayed on web applications that can be accessed from anywhere.

In carrying out its activities, PT. Regency Motor is assisted by employees who have a good work ethic. PT. Regency Motor selected the best employees who would later be given prizes as a result of the employee's hard work. This selection process often experiences several problems such as the calculation of employee criterion values that often experience similarities between one another. The best employee selection process involves all employees working at PT. Regency Motor. This process has several assessment stages which can take a long time in calculating the value of each employee. In these processes it is not uncommon for errors to occur in both the input of employee values and in the process of calculating those values. Therefore in this study the author tries to try to help the company to determine the best employees by using the Technique for Order Reference by Similarity to Ideal Solution (TOPSIS) method more effectively, because the TOPSIS method is one of the best alternatives that is able to produce employee data with using six criteria, namely discipline, loyalty, attitude, attendance, expertise and years of service, the final calculation result is obtained to determine the best employee obtained with the prefence value at the highest value, Alex Ryan with a value of 0.7592812
